Web5 de abr. de 2024 · Responding to climate change involves two possible approaches: reducing and stabilizing the levels of heat-trapping greenhouse gases in the atmosphere … WebTaxes and charges can set a “carbon price” (a cost for each unit of greenhouse gas emissions) and be an effective mitigation incentive, but cannot guarantee a particular level of emissions. Tradable emission permits establish a “carbon price”. The volume of allowed emissions determines their environmental effectiveness, while the way ...
